own power levels ranging from low to high. Power level
settings necessary for cooking will vary depending on the
cookware being used, the type and quantity of food, and
the desired outcome. In general use lower settings for
melting, holding and simmering and use higher settings for
heating quickly, searing and frying. When keeping foods
warm, confirm selected setting is sufficient to maintain food
temperature above 140°F. Larger elements and elements
marked “Keep Warm” are not recommended for melting.

Hi is the highest power level, designed for large quantity
rapid cooking and boiling. Hi will operate for a maximum of
10 minutes. Hi may be repeated after the initial 10 minute
cycle by either pressing the - pad followed by the + pad
OR swiping the power level arc to a lower level and then
followed by swiping the power level arc to the highest
level.

CAUTION

Do not place any cookware, utensils or

leave excess water spills on control key pads. This may
result in unresponsive touch pads and turning off the
cooktop if present for several seconds.

SYNCHRONIZE LEFT ELEMENTS

NOTE:

Sync Burners is only intended for cookware that spans both burners.

To Turn On

Hold the

Sync Burners

pad for about half a second

to connect the two burners. Operate either element as
described on page 12 to adjust power level.

To Turn Off

1. Touch the

On/Off

pad on either burner to turn off the

Sync Burners.

or

2. Touch the

Sync Burners

to turn both burners off.
